A Masterclass Certificate in Ecotherapy Techniques provides comprehensive training in nature-based therapeutic interventions. Participants gain a deep understanding of the theoretical frameworks underpinning ecotherapy, including its applications in mental health and wellbeing.
The program's learning outcomes focus on practical skills development. Upon completion, graduates will be proficient in designing and delivering ecotherapy sessions, adapting their approach to diverse client needs and environmental settings. This includes mastering techniques such as mindful nature walks, nature journaling, and horticultural therapy.
